Laurent PICHET was born 22 January 1786 in Saint-Jean-de-l'Île-d'Orléans, Province of Québec, Canada

Laurent PICHET was the child of Joseph PICHET   and   Marie-Marguerite FILTEAU and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Louis PICHET and Dorothee NOEL (maternal)  Antoine FILTEAU (FEUILLETEAU) and Marie-Josephe METHOT

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Laurent  married  Françoise TREMBLAY 15 September 1812 in Sainte-Famille-de-l'île-d'Orléans, Lower Canada .  Françoise TREMBLAY  was born 2 February 1790 in Sainte-Famille-de-l'île-d'Orléans, Québec, Canada.  Françoise died 4 March 1865 in Sainte-Famille-de-l'île-d'Orléans, Québec, Canada.  Françoise was the child of Joseph TREMBLAY and Francoise TRUDEL.
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
